OK, got it to work. does the info need to be in sectiosn in order to have
that info appear...in other words, can someone sign the entire form and have
the details show up?

Alex said:
About seeing the signature: use "allow users to sign this section" - as
opposed to signing the entire form. Then, right under the section, you
will see the digital signature details.
